About This Collaboration

Jayaprakash & Riyaz Khan have worked together on 4 films in Indian cinema. Their collaboration began in 2010 and extends to 2024, representing 14 years of joint work. Working Jayaprakash as Actor and Riyaz Khan as Actor, their pairing brought together complementary creative strengths that carved out a distinctive niche despite uneven audience reception.

Among their most acclaimed works are "Vandae Maatharam", "Aagam ", "Yaaruku Theriyum" — with "Vandae Maatharam" earning a top rating of 6.5/10. Across all their joint films, they maintain an average audience rating of 4.2/10 — an average that reflects a challenging run — several films fell below audience expectations.

Their most productive period was the 2010s, when they delivered 3 films that shaped the era's cinema. The bulk of their work is in Tamil cinema. From "Vandae Maatharam" (2010) to "Petta Rap" (2024), their partnership has evolved through shifting industry landscapes while maintaining its artistic core.

Career Context

Jayaprakash

Before Vandae Maatharam, Jayaprakash had starred in 7 films, including Naadodigal (2009) and Pasanga (2009).

After Petta Rap, Jayaprakash went on to appear in 9 more films, including Maaman (2025) and 2K Love Story (2025).

Riyaz Khan

Before Vandae Maatharam, Riyaz Khan had starred in 29 films, including Dongodu (2003) and Athma (1993).
